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Grease a 9x13-inch casserole dish with nonstick spray or a little oil.
In a skillet, cook 1 lb of ground beef or sausage over medium heat. Add Italian seasoning, garlic powder (optional), salt, and pepper. Cook until the meat is browned, about 7–8 minutes. Drain any excess grease.
Stir in 1½ cups of pizza sauce with the meat. Let it simmer for 2–3 minutes. Spoon the meat mixture into the prepared casserole dish and spread it out evenly.
Sprinkle 2 cups of mozzarella cheese on top, and add ½ cup of cheddar cheese if you like. Add your favorite toppings like pepperoni or veggies.
Place frozen tater tots on top, covering the whole dish.
Bake for 35–40 minutes, until the tater tots are golden brown and crispy. For extra crispiness, broil for 2–3 minutes, but watch closely to avoid burning.
Let the casserole sit for 5–10 minutes before serving to let it set.
